Output cfa7a65a57feee8095de786cad2f8d25cf4a50ca34c6841a039051a595cb308b:3

value
1019786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d994a40e54b9153bedbdfd08234cfb159fa7c398 OP_EQUAL
address
3MXUcvBqU1w814bR7L3EhcGfEBVbtpet1S
transaction
cfa7a65a57feee8095de786cad2f8d25cf4a50ca34c6841a039051a595cb308b
confirmations
373435
spent
true